How to Make a Vision Board That Really Works

How to Make a Vision Board That Really Works

A vision board isn’t just a collage of pretty pictures — it’s a tool to clarify your goals, inspire action, and keep your dreams visible every day. When done thoughtfully, it becomes a daily reminder of what matters most. Here’s how to make one that actually works.


📝 Start With Clarity

Before you gather images or cutouts, take a moment to get clear on what you truly want. Think about your career, health, relationships, personal growth, and hobbies. The more honest you are with yourself, the more your vision board will actually reflect you and guide your decisions.

Quick tips:

  • Write down both short-term and long-term goals.

  • Identify what would make you feel fulfilled this year.

  • Be honest — your board only works if it’s truly yours.


🎨 Gather Your Materials

Once your goals are clear, bring them to life visually. Choose a board that works for you — corkboard, poster board, magnetic board, or digital. Collect images, quotes, or objects that resonate emotionally. Your board should feel alive and inviting, not cluttered.

Ideas to try:

  • Magazines, photos, sticky notes, or printed affirmations.

  • Include colors, textures, or symbols that inspire you.

  • Mix final goals with progress markers.

  • Keep it simple and visually appealing.


🔍 Focus on Feeling, Not Just Looks

A vision board works best when it evokes emotion. It’s not just about listing goals — it’s about feeling motivated and excited each time you see it.

Ways to focus on emotion:

  • Choose images that make you feel happy, confident, or energized.

  • Add affirmations that inspire action.

  • Keep only what sparks strong feelings.

  • Include symbols of progress, not just final outcomes.


📌 Place It Where You’ll See It

Visibility is key. A vision board can’t inspire action if it’s tucked away. Put it somewhere you encounter daily so it can gently reinforce your goals.

Placement tips:

  • Hang it above your desk or next to your bed.

  • For digital boards, set it as your phone or computer wallpaper.

  • Rotate or update images as your goals evolve.


✏️ Take Action Alongside It

A vision board guides your focus, but it’s action that moves you forward. Break your goals into small steps, track your progress, and celebrate wins along the way.

Action steps:

  • Identify tasks you can do today, this week, or this month.

  • Mark milestones on your board for motivation.

  • Adjust your board as priorities shift.


💡 Keep It Personal and Flexible

Your vision board should feel uniquely yours. Avoid comparing it to others — it’s a reflection of your own journey, creativity, and motivation. Update it as you grow, and let it inspire without creating pressure.

Personalization tips:

  • Include items that bring you joy and motivation.

  • Allow creativity — it can be symbolic, literal, or abstract.

  • Let it evolve as your goals change.


✨ The Secret to a Vision Board That Works

The real power of a vision board comes not from magic images, but from clarity, consistent action, and daily reinforcement. By keeping your goals visible and meaningful, it becomes a simple yet effective tool to guide your focus and motivation. Pair your vision board with intentional effort, and it can transform your ideas into reality.
